Common Rocklin HOA Requirements

Most associations specify an approved wood or vinyl profile, a maximum height (commonly six feet at rear and side, lower at front), and an approved color range for vinyl. Some require neighbor notification or matching an adjoining approved fence on shared lines.

Newer phases occasionally update their design guidelines after original construction, so a like-for-like replacement doesn't always guarantee automatic approval — we check the current version before ordering material.

Frequently asked questions

Can my Rocklin HOA reject a fence after it's installed?

Yes, if it was built without written approval or off the approved plan — always wait for sign-off before we order materials.

Does a like-for-like replacement still need approval?

In most Rocklin communities, yes, even for a like-for-like swap — design guidelines occasionally update, and committees like a paper trail regardless.
